Income & Employment in Coon Rapids
The median household income in Coon Rapids is $86,618 according to Census ACS data. The unemployment rate is 3.1%. The city's population grew 0.5% recently, indicating strong demand.
Safety in Coon Rapids
Coon Rapids has a violent crime rate of 185.9 per 100,000 residents. This is considered low, making it one of the safer cities in the state. The property crime rate is 1556.3 per 100,000.
Cost of Living in Coon Rapids
Coon Rapids has a cost of living index of 104.5 (where 100 equals the national average), which is near the national average. The median home value is $287,200. Median monthly rent is $1,418.

Education & Schools in Coon Rapids
Coon Rapids has 15 public schools serving 8,288 students. The high school graduation rate is 84.4%, a solid rate. The student-teacher ratio is 15.1:1. The district spends $15,300 per student. School data is sourced from the NCES Common Core of Data and EDFacts.
Climate in Coon Rapids
Coon Rapids has an annual average temperature of 48.3Β°F. Summers average 72.2Β°F. Winters average 24.5Β°F. The city receives approximately 40.3 inches of precipitation per year.
